Coconut Truffles 

a pile of Chocolate Coconut Truffles covered on Seeds

Boost Your Truffles with Coconut Cashew SuperMix!

   Ingredients

        • ½ Cup Raw Coconut Oil

        • ¼ Cup Pure Maple Syrup

        • 1 Cup Cacao Powder

        • 1 TBSP Cold Water

        • 1 Bag of Sol-ti Coconut Cashew SuperMix

  Instructions

1. Begin by combining the coconut oil and pure maple

syrup. Mix well until the two ingredients are thoroughly

incorporated.


2. Gradually sift the cacao powder into the wet ingredients. 

Stir continuously to avoid lumps and ensure a smooth 

chocolatey mixture.


3. Add the cold water to the chocolate mixture. This helps 

achieve a desirable consistency for shaping the truffles. 


4. Place the mixture in the refrigerator for at least 30 

minutes or until it becomes firm enough to handle.


5. Once the mixture has chilled, use your hands to scoop 

and roll small portions into bite-sized truffles. You can also 

use a spoon or a melon baller for uniform shapes.


6. Use a heavy ladle or rolling pin to crush the SuperMix in 

the bag. Add the SuperMix to a shallow dish. Roll the truffles 

on the SuperMix until they are completely coated. 


7. Place the shaped truffles back in the refrigerator for 

another 30 minutes to set completely.


8. Once chilled, Serve.
